Conway, Bevin spew venom in debate

Democratic Attorney General Jack Conway and Republican Matt Bevin traded more barbs in a bitter debate Tuesday over same-sex marriage, state pensions and the racial makeup of trustees at the University of Louisville. But the rivalry was put at ease at times by independent candidate Drew Curtis, a digital entrepreneur who touted his technology background as a unique qualification to move the state forward. The debate was held at Bellarmine University and was the first televised debate of the campaign.
